Brainstorming the 'Neuroethics of Brain-Computer Interfaces' – present and future

"The field of BCI [brain-computer interface] technology is now migrating from being almost entirely limited to academic research labs into a mainstream social phenomenon. With significant increases in computational power and sophistication of machine learning, BCIs are increasingly promising (or threatening) to become a fixture of the new 'human condition.'"
